Under fixed reaction conditions, is there a formula to calculate the dry point based on the fractional distillation conditions?

In chemical processing, the operating conditions of the distillation tower indeed affect the dry point of the overhead product. The term “dryness” usually refers to the molar fraction of volatile components in a product, and is generally used to describe the purity of the product. Calculating the dry point generally requires the following steps: 1. **Data collection**: First, it is necessary to know operational parameters such as the feed composition of the distillation column, the reflux ratio inside the column, and the number of trays. 2. **Use a vapor equilibrium model**: Utilize ideal or non-ideal distillation models (such as the ideal stage model, McCabe-Thiele method, etc.), along with relevant physical property data (such as boiling points and phase equilibrium relationships), to simulate the fractional distillation process. These models can help predict the composition of the top and bottom products under specific reflux ratios and feed conditions. 3. **Dry point calculation**: Among the compositions of the top-product obtained through model calculations, the mole fraction of the lightest component (such as ethanol in the water/ethanol distillation) is referred to as the dry point. 4. **Adjust operating conditions to optimize the dry point**: The dry point can be optimized by adjusting parameters such as the reflux ratio, feed position, and number of tray levels. Increasing the reflux ratio usually raises the dry point, that is, it improves the purity of the top product, but it also increases energy consumption. The choice of specific formula or model depends on the complexity of the distillation system and the required precision. In practical applications, using specialized chemical process simulation software (such as Aspen Plus, HYSYS, etc.) can provide more accurate and convenient simulation results. These software programs incorporate a large amount of material property data and advanced calculation models; by entering the operating conditions and feed characteristics, the software automatically calculates the dry point and other important operational parameters. .
